What is Maine Medical BAA

The Maine Medical Association Business Associate Agreement is a legal document used by healthcare providers to establish terms for handling protected health information in compliance with HIPAA regulations.

What is the Maine Medical Association Business Associate Agreement?

The Maine Medical Association Business Associate Agreement is a critical legal document that establishes the terms under which a Covered Entity, such as a medical practice, and a Business Associate, like a service provider, manage Protected Health Information (PHI). This agreement is essential for compliance with HIPAA regulations, ensuring that both parties understand their responsibilities in safeguarding sensitive information.
This agreement outlines the relationship between the Covered Entity and Business Associate, emphasizing their roles in maintaining the confidentiality and security of PHI. Its legal significance cannot be understated since it serves as a safeguard against data breaches and the associated penalties for non-compliance.

Key Features of the Maine Medical Association Business Associate Agreement

This agreement contains several crucial elements that dictate how PHI should be managed. Key obligations include the Business Associate's responsibility for safeguarding PHI, adhering to specified permitted uses and disclosures, and implementing adequate security measures.
  • Obligations of the Business Associate regarding PHI
  • Permitted uses and disclosures of information
  • Safeguarding measures outlined in the agreement
  • Requirements for reporting and addressing breaches
Clearly articulating these features within the agreement helps in establishing a mutual understanding of data management protocols and compliance expectations.
